Training AI with Behavior Cloning: Street Fighter 6 Imitation Learning (22 Epochs)
Автор: AI Plays God
Загружено: 2026-02-21
Просмотров: 93
Описание:
I trained an AI to play Street Fighter 6 using Behavior Cloning! 🤖🎮
In this video, I walk through my entire process of teaching an artificial intelligence to play fighting games by watching my gameplay. Using Stable Baselines 3 and imitation learning, I recorded myself playing as Ryu against Ken at difficulty level 5, then trained a neural network for 22 epochs to copy my playstyle.
This is a beginner-friendly explanation of machine learning in gaming, but I also dive into the technical details for AI enthusiasts. Whether you're curious about AI, love Street Fighter, or want to learn about Behavior Cloning, this video breaks it all down.
Code:
https://github.com/paulo101977/sdlarc...
🎯 WHAT YOU'LL LEARN:
How Behavior Cloning works (explained simply)
Why fighting games are perfect for AI research
My complete training process with Stable Baselines 3
Challenges and limitations of imitation learning
Real results: watching the AI play
⏱️ TIMESTAMPS:
0:00 - Introduction
0:30 - My Setup: Ryu vs Ken at Level 5
1:30 - What is Behavior Cloning?
2:45 - Why Street Fighter 6?
3:40 - The Training Process (22 Epochs)
8:25 - Results & AI Gameplay
9:53 - Another & Next Steps
🔧 TECHNICAL DETAILS:
Framework: Stable Baselines 3 (Imitation Learning)
Game: Street Fighter 6
Character: Ryu (Player 1) vs Ken (CPU Level 5)
Training: 22 epochs of supervised learning
Method: Behavior Cloning from human demonstrations
🤖 WHAT IS BEHAVIOR CLONING?
Behavior Cloning is a form of imitation learning where an AI learns to perform tasks by observing expert demonstrations. Instead of programming rules, the AI watches gameplay, learns patterns, and tries to replicate human decision-making.
📚 RESOURCES:
Stable Baselines 3 Documentation: https://stable-baselines3.readthedocs...
Imitation Learning Library: https://imitation.readthedocs.io/
Street Fighter 6: https://www.streetfighter.com/6/
💬 LET'S CONNECT:
What should I try next? Different characters? Higher difficulty? Reinforcement Learning? Drop your suggestions in the comments!
👍 If you enjoyed this video, please LIKE and SUBSCRIBE for more AI gaming experiments!
🔔 Turn on notifications so you don't miss future updates on this project!
---
#ArtificialIntelligence #MachineLearning #StreetFighter6 #BehaviorCloning #AIGaming #DeepLearning #ImitationLearning #GameAI #NeuralNetworks #StableBaselines3 #FightingGames #TechTutorial #AIExperiment
Повторяем попытку...
Доступные форматы для скачивания:
Скачать видео
-
Информация по загрузке: